Assessing Your Yard and Preparation the Design
When you're prepared to install a sprinkler system, the very first step is examining your yard and planning the format. Begin by observing the size and shape of your backyard. Recognize locations that need watering, such as flower beds, lawns, and veggie gardens. Remember of sun exposure and any kind of shaded places, as these factors affect water demands.
Following, consider the water stress available to you. Examine it utilizing a simple pressure gauge to confirm your system can function successfully. Plan the positioning of lawn sprinkler heads based on insurance coverage; you'll want them to overlap somewhat to avoid dry spots.
Sketch a harsh format, marking the places of the major lines and sprinkler heads. Assume about the kinds of lawn sprinklers you'll use and their reach. Planning carefully now will certainly make your installation simpler and validate your plants receive the ideal quantity of water.

Noting the Lawn Sprinkler Layout
As you start noting the automatic sprinkler design, think about the design of your backyard and the locations that need one of the most protection. Start by determining areas like flower beds, yards, and vegetable gardens that need constant watering. Use flags or stakes to detail the areas where you intend to mount the lawn sprinklers.
Following, validate you account for obstacles, such as trees or outdoor patios, which could block water distribution. Measure distances thoroughly to establish the most effective placement for each sprinkler head. Remember to space them evenly, complying with the maker's suggestions for protection.
You could intend to illustration a straightforward layout of your layout to envision the format much better. This will certainly aid you make changes as required. Ultimately, ascertain your significant locations to verify that each zone is sufficiently covered before carrying on to the following action in your setup process.

Determining Trench Depth
Figuring out the ideal trench deepness is essential for ensuring your lawn sprinkler works properly. Generally, you'll wish to dig trenches about 6 to 12 inches deep, depending upon your regional environment and the kind of pipes you're utilizing. Much deeper trenches aid prevent pipes from freezing if you live in an area with freezing temperatures. Make certain to think about the size of your pipes; larger pipes might need much deeper trenches for proper installation. In addition, inspect regional codes or policies, as they might determine particular depth needs. As you dig, maintain the trench width manageable-- around 12 inches is generally adequate. In this manner, you can quickly mount and access the pipelines when required, ensuring your system runs efficiently.

Setting Up Sprinkler Heads and Valves
Installing sprinkler heads and shutoffs is a vital step in producing an effective watering system for your grass or garden (Sprinkler installation). Begin by placing the sprinkler heads at the significant areas, making specific they're evenly spaced for ideal insurance coverage. Dig a little hole for each and every head, verifying it's deep enough for correct setup
Next, connect the sprinkler heads to the pipelines, protecting them tightly to protect against leaks. Use Teflon tape on the strings for extra guarantee.
When it pertains to valves, select a location conveniently available for upkeep. Set up the shutoffs according to the maker's instructions, attaching them to the mainline pipes. Make sure they're degree and safe, as this will aid with constant water flow.
Lastly, test each lawn sprinkler head and shutoff for proper function before hiding any kind of pipelines. This action guarantees your system runs smoothly and successfully, offering the very best care for your plants.
